What is the cheapest month to fly to Panama City?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ights to Panama City,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ights to Panama City is January, where tickets cost R20 355 on average for return flights. On the other hand, the most expensive months are August and July, where the average cost of tickets from South Africa is R38 154 and R32 575 respectively. For one-way flights, the best month to travel is February with an average price of R19 941.

How far in advance should I book a flight to Panama City?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ights to Panama City,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price, you should book around 2 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 15 weeks before departure.

  • What is the name of Panama City’s airport?

    When flying to Panama City, you'll arrive at Panama City Tocumen Intl Airport (PTY). The airport is also known as Tocumen or Tocumen Intl.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ights to Panama City?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Panama City with an airline and back with another airline.
